随着信息技术的飞速发展,数据已经成为现代社会的重要资源。海量数据的处理和计算需求日益增长,算力调度实验室应运而生,成为未来计算的核心。本文将深入揭秘算力调度实验室,探讨其如何高效分配海量数据。

一、算力调度实验室的背景与意义

1.1 背景

在传统的计算模式中,计算资源(如CPU、GPU、内存等)通常被固定分配给特定的任务。然而,随着云计算、大数据、人工智能等技术的发展,计算资源的需求变得多样化、动态化。为了满足这些需求,算力调度实验室应运而生。

1.2 意义

算力调度实验室的核心目标是提高计算资源的利用率,实现高效的数据处理和计算。这对于推动科技创新、提高生产效率、降低成本具有重要意义。

二、算力调度实验室的工作原理

2.1 资源监控

算力调度实验室首先需要对计算资源进行实时监控,包括CPU、GPU、内存、存储等。这可以通过各种监控工具和软件实现。

2.2 任务调度

在了解资源状况后,算力调度实验室需要根据任务的需求和优先级进行调度。调度算法是关键,常见的调度算法包括:

  • 优先级调度:根据任务的优先级进行调度,优先级高的任务优先执行。
  • 轮转调度:将任务均匀分配到各个计算资源上,实现负载均衡。
  • 基于实时性调度:根据任务的实时性要求进行调度,确保任务在规定时间内完成。

2.3 资源优化

算力调度实验室还需要对资源进行优化,以提高整体性能。这包括:

  • 负载均衡:将任务均匀分配到各个计算资源上,避免资源过度利用或闲置。
  • 资源预留:为重要任务预留计算资源,确保任务能够及时完成。
  • 动态调整:根据任务执行情况和资源状况动态调整调度策略。

三、算力调度实验室的应用案例

3.1 云计算平台

云计算平台是算力调度实验室的重要应用场景。通过算力调度,云计算平台可以实现资源的灵活分配和高效利用,提高服务质量。

3.2 大数据分析

在大数据分析领域,算力调度实验室可以实现对海量数据的快速处理和分析,为企业提供决策支持。

3.3 人工智能

人工智能领域对计算资源的需求极高。算力调度实验室可以帮助人工智能应用高效地运行,提高研发效率。

四、总结

算力调度实验室作为未来计算的核心,在高效分配海量数据方面发挥着重要作用。通过资源监控、任务调度和资源优化,算力调度实验室能够满足不同场景下的计算需求,推动科技创新和社会发展。